Output 51ba3f261c00fa48486dd8f0def3e21fc031091a5d4b0ac007db64b8f5aa1ba5:6

value
985954
script pubkey
OP_0 OP_PUSHBYTES_20 3d5a92f4b090951296e91e6d095eec12b4ca6191
address
bc1q84df9a9sjz2399hfreksjhhvz26v5cv3qmtnvq
transaction
51ba3f261c00fa48486dd8f0def3e21fc031091a5d4b0ac007db64b8f5aa1ba5
spent
true